Transaction f8570276c9051957be63cd958e104fc42a8b7ad659ed6a26f516f97e57de289e

1 Input
2 Outputs
  • f8570276c9051957be63cd958e104fc42a8b7ad659ed6a26f516f97e57de289e:0
  • value  616981
    address  34Uyzu5iVWffPn5qJW5t1D4se1VF94cFyy
  • f8570276c9051957be63cd958e104fc42a8b7ad659ed6a26f516f97e57de289e:1
  • value  62673001
    address  1M2YohLx5tdyCiAGRiShzppxp26WMwEbxP